Fokalgrid
Fokalgrid, or focal grid, is a calibration feature used in optical instrumentation to project or imprint a regular grid pattern at the focal plane of a camera, spectrograph, or telescope imager. It provides a known reference geometry that enables precise assessment of the instrument’s optical performance, including alignment, scale, and distortion.
